Jordan has recorded 61 deaths and 4,580 new COVID-19 cases Friday, bringing the total number of cases since the beginning of the crisis to 207,601.

The death toll since the beginning of the crisis is 2,570.

The cases are:

  • 1,442 in Amman
  • 648 in Mafraq
  • 365 in Zarqa
  • 158 in Tafilah
  • 138 in Karak
  • 72 in Ma'an, including 26 in Petra
  • 867 in Irbid, including 146 in Ramtha
  • 371 in Jerash
  • 186 in Madaba
  • 146 in Balqa
  • 126 in Ajloun
  • 61 in Aqaba

A total of 234 cases have been admitted to the hospitals, and 194 have been discharged upon recovery.

There are a total of 64,694 active COVID-19 cases.

A total of 4,750 recoveries have been recorded from hospitals and home quarantine, bringing the total amount of recoveries since the beginning of the coronavirus crisis to 140,400.

There are 2,092 patients receiving treatment in hospitals, including 485 in the Intensive Care Units.

A total of 26,257 PCR tests have been conducted, bringing the total number of tests conducted since the beginning of the crisis to 2,487,561.

Friday, 17.4 percent of PCR tests have come back positive.
